1. Ondersteuning voor MQTT-versie
Wij ondersteunen de 3. x versie. Wij ondersteunen echter geen 5. x.
2. Reduxi Controller MQTT API-documentatie
Documentatie van alle beschikbare MQTT-onderwerpen en abonnementsmethoden is beschikbaar op:
MQTT-documentatie wordt gegenereerd vanuit het oogpunt van Reduxi Controller.
Wanneer u leest vanuit Reduxi MQTT, ziet u de term "PUB". Waarom PUB? Omdat we de gegevens van Reduxi Controller naar het onderwerp publiceren.
Wanneer u waarden instelt voor Reduxi Controller via MQTT, ziet u de term "SUB". Waarom SUB? Omdat we ons abonneren op het onderwerp en er gegevens uit lezen, stellen we de waarden in die u naar de Reduxi Controller hebt verzonden.
Hieronder vindt u informatie over hoe u de Reduxi Configurator moet instellen, zodat u gegevens over specifieke MQTT-brokers ontvangt. In de laatste alinea ziet u een voorbeeld van één uitlezing en het instellen van de instelpunten op één apparaat.
3. Reduxi MQTT-interfaceconfiguratie
Meld u aan bij het Reduxi Controller-apparaat en ga naar de systeeminstellingen. Selecteer onder Systeeminstellingen MQTT v3 en definieer MQTT-brokergegevens:
- Host (alleen domein/IP, zonder mqtts://)
- Haven
- Gebruikersnaam
- Wachtwoord
4. Windows-client
U kunt proberen gegevens te verzamelen door MQTT Explorer te gebruiken en verbinding te maken met de MQTT-broker met het volgende:
U kunt verbinding maken met de MQTT-broker wanneer u een MQTT-explorertoepassing start.
5. Opdrachten
5.1. Metagegevens vernieuwen
Verzoek Reduxi om alle metadata over het systeem, de apparaten en de strategieën opnieuw te publiceren naar MQTT. Anders worden alleen de uitlezingen en instelpunten periodiek gepubliceerd.
Onderwerp: controllers/controller_unit_id/commands/refresh
5.2. Opnieuw opstarten
Kunt u de Reduxi Controller opnieuw opstarten?
Onderwerp: controllers/controller_unit_id/commands/refresh
6. Instelpunten
6.1. Bekijk alle actieve setpoints voor het apparaat
6.2. Stel instelpunten in voor het apparaat
6.2.1. Voorbeeld 1
Stel het actieve vermogen in op -1 kW (export) op alle fasen gedurende 15 seconden.
{
"waarden": [
{
"actie": "INSTELLEN",
"type": "POWER_ACTIVE",
"doel": "VAST",
"faseType": null,
"waarde": 1000,
"prioriteit": 10000,
"geldigVoorTijd": 15000
}
]
}
6.2.2. Voorbeeld 2
Beperk de maximale stroomsterkte tot 10A op fase L2 gedurende 30 seconden.
{
"waarden": [
{
"actie": "INSTELLEN",
"type": "HUIDIG",
"doel": "MAX",
"faseType": "L2",
"waarde": 10,
"prioriteit": 10000,
"geldigVoorTijd": 30000
}
]
}
Opmerkingen
0 opmerkingen
Artikel is gesloten voor opmerkingen.